The doors of perception is a short book by aldous huxley, first published in 1954, detailing his experiences when taking mescaline. The doors of perception and heaven and hell detail the practicalities of the experiment and give huxleys vivid account of his immediate experience and the more prolonged effect upon his subsequent thinking and awareness. The book takes the form of huxleys recollection of a mescaline trip that took place over the course of an afternoon in may 1953. The doors of perception is his account of his experience that day.

Mescaline is the principal agent of the psychedelic cactus peyote, which has been used in american religious ceremonies for thousands of years.
